Meaning

分歧 refers to a divergence or difference, most commonly in opinions, views, or paths. It describes situations where two or more parties have differing perspectives or where things branch off in different directions. The word carries a neutral tone and is frequently used in formal contexts to discuss disagreements without implying hostility.

Usage

This word is common in formal speech, writing, news reports, and diplomatic language. It often appears in phrases like 产生分歧 (to develop differences) or 存在分歧 (differences exist). While it indicates disagreement, it's less confrontational than words like 争论 (argument) and is appropriate for professional settings.

Examples

  1. 01
    双方在这个问题上存在严重分歧
    Shuāng fāng zài zhège wèntí shàng cún zài yánzhòng fēn .
    The two sides have serious differences on this issue.
  2. 02
    我们需要坐下来讨论,解决彼此之间的分歧
    Wǒmen yào zuò xiàlái tǎolùn, jiějué bǐcǐ zhī jiān de fēn .
    We need to sit down and discuss to resolve the differences between us.

Common collocations

  • 产生分歧
    chǎn shēng fēn
    to develop differences/disagreement
  • 存在分歧
    cún zài fēn
    differences exist
  • 解决分歧
    jiě jué fēn
    to resolve differences
  • 意见分歧
    jiàn fēn
    difference of opinion

Origin

The compound combines 分 (to divide/separate) with 歧 (forked path/divergent), literally meaning a forking or branching apart. This concrete image of paths splitting naturally extended to abstract differences in opinion or perspective.
